Output 3bc66bdf370e940d0913b201a6a5505793fb1f173a89c964887e154067649da9:29

value
8526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c585a4658af221d079876565df45394b7187f62722779bff8a17ccaa06ee7bbd
address
bc1pckz6gev27gsaq7v8v4ja73fefdcc0a38yfmehlu2zlx25phw0w7sfdyrn0
transaction
3bc66bdf370e940d0913b201a6a5505793fb1f173a89c964887e154067649da9
spent
true